С Sharp Для здачі тесту потрібна реєстрація (Прізвище, щоб я зрозумів). Тількі латинські букви або цифри. Ласкаво просимо до Основи ООП та мови програмування C# 1. Кожен оператор C# закінчується ___. , . ; : 2. Що буде результатом наведеного нижче коду C#? int a = 10, b = 20; Console.WriteLine("{0},{0}", a, b); 10,20 20,20 error 10,10 3. int x = 0; x+=10; Після виконання коду змінна x міститиме 0 буде помилка при компіляції 10 4. Які з наведених типів даних є в C#? Більше однієї відповіді decimal int string float 5. Який правильний метод(и) для введення значення з плаваючою точкою в C#? ToSingle(Console.ReadLine()) Parse(Console.ReadLine()) обидві відповіді вірні 6. Які цикли існують у мові C#? for for, while for, while, do while, foreach for, while, do while 7. Який правильний синтаксис оператора foreach у C#? foreach(type variable_name in collection_name) { statement(s); } foreach(type variable_name in collection_name); { statement(s); } foreach(dim type variable_name in collection_name) { statement(s); } 8. Що виконає наступний код? int x = 5; int y = x--; Console.WriteLine(y); 0 5 4 3 9. Що відбудеться, якщо ввести некоректний формат даних для int.Parse(Console.ReadLine())? Програма автоматично переведе у правильний формат Програма завершиться без повідомлення Виникне виняток (Exception) Програма виконає обчислення з 0 10. Який результат даст наступний код int a = 10; Console.WriteLine(А+А); 10 20 повідомлення про помилку 11. Який метод використовується для конвертації рядка в число? Int.Parse() String.ToNumber() ToInt32() Convert.ToInt() 12. Які типи змінних існують? int, char, bool, string Усі перелічені int, char, bool, float, double int, char, bool, float, double, uint, short 13. Чи підтримує C# цикл foreach? Так Ні 14. Яка основна різниця між Console.WriteLine() та Console.Write()? WriteLine() працює лише з символами, а Write() – з рядками WriteLine() додає новий рядок після виводу, а Write() – ні WriteLine() використовує текстовий формат, а Write() – числовий 15. Для розробки чого використовується мова програмування C# Настольних додатків Все перераховане Мобільних додатків Веб додатків